ECR PARTNERSHIPS AND PRACTICE GROUPS DEPARTMENT (ECRPG)

ECR’s Partnerships and Practice Groups department builds relationships with external stakeholders and guides the external outreach, engagement and positioning of WBG thought leadership to help deliver development outcomes and country impact.

ECRPG manages communications and engagement within the World Bank’s four Practice Groups and the Development Economics Vice Presidency. Through its Engagement and Partnerships team, it guides strategic engagement with civil society, faith-based organizations, parliamentarians, philanthropic organizations, private sector, local communities and drives advocacy and campaign initiatives—all with a view to helping the Bank Group deliver on its mission.

ECRPG teams working in the Practice Groups operate across the Global Practices-Regional-Corporate nexus, to drive momentum for global issues to deliver stronger country outcomes and keep attention on the most pressing development issues of our times.

Within the ECRPG team, ECREF is the division that provides strategic communication guidance to the Equitable Growth, Finance and Institutions Practice Group (EFI) and the Development Economics (DEC) department. The EFI Practice Group encompasses four Global Practices: Governance; Finance, Competitiveness & Innovation; Macroeconomics, Trade & Investment; and Poverty & Equity. The Development Economics Department leads the Bank’s research and data work and is responsible for a number of flagship publications.

The ECREF team works to ensure that high impact strategic communication approaches, aligned to EFI, DEC and corporate priorities, are deployed across the Practice Group, Global Practices and DEC. This includes a focus on strong messages, stakeholder engagement, reputation risk management, leadership communications, and advocacy.
